发明名称 |
基于OSGI的类加载隔离系统和方法 |
摘要 |
本发明提供一种基于OSGI的类加载隔离系统和方法,所述系统包括:转换器,用于将web应用转换为标准wab;处理器,用于为所述web应用创建虚拟组件集合;过滤器,用于为所述虚拟组件集合设置隔离关系。所述方法包括:S1:将web应用转换成标准wab,并为所述web应用创建虚拟组件集合;S2:为所述虚拟组件集合创建过滤器;S3:根据所述过滤器中的可见性列表,为所述虚拟组件集合设置隔离关系。本发明通过提出一种基于OSGI的类加载隔离系统和方法,是面向JavaEE平台下的web应用,根据具体需求细粒度的控制应用间类隔离性和服务的隔离性,且配置更加灵活。 |
申请公布号 |
CN103116510A |
申请公布日期 |
2013.05.22 |
申请号 |
CN201310026972.3 |
申请日期 |
2013.01.21 |
申请人 |
北京东方通科技股份有限公司 |
发明人 |
于洋 |
分类号 |
G06F9/445(2006.01)I |
主分类号 |
G06F9/445(2006.01)I |
代理机构 |
北京路浩知识产权代理有限公司 11002 |
代理人 |
王莹 |
主权项 |
一种基于OSGI的类加载隔离系统,其特征在于,所述系统包括:转换器,用于将web应用转换为标准wab;处理器,用于为所述web应用创建虚拟组件集合;过滤器,用于为所述虚拟组件集合设置隔离关系。 |
地址 |
100080 北京市海淀区彩和坊路10号1+1大厦3层 |